Celebrating Messi's Milestones on June 16
June 16 holds a significant place in Lionel Messi's illustrious football journey. On this day in 2006, he marked a monumental moment by netting his first World Cup goal for the Argentina national team during a match against Serbia and Montenegro. This goal was part of a stunning 6-0 victory for La Albiceleste.
